Shopping Mall nearby 55 MRT Ave, New Lower Bicutan, Taguig, 1632 Metro Manila, Philippines

 
Showing 1 - 3 of 3

Shopping Mall

Approx 1.33 KM away

Address: Cuasay, Taguig, Metro Manila, Philippines

Shopping Mall

Approx 1.34 KM away

Address: FTI Complex, DBP Avenue, Taguig, Metro Manila, Philippines

Shopping Mall

Approx 1.35 KM away

Address: Avocado Road, Food Terminal Incorporated, Taguig, 1633 Metro Manila, Philippines

Showing 1 - 3 of 3